How did the language of The Divine Comedy differ from other philosophical works of the Middle Ages? What effect did Dante’s deci
mojhsa [17]

During the Middle Ages, almost all philosophers used to write in Latin- the language of educated and elite class while as Dante wrote his best poem Divine Comedy in vernacular, Italian language-the language of common people.

Dante's decision to write in Italian had a long lasting impact on Italian language. It paved the way for Italian to emerge as a language respect across the European landscape. There were more innovations in this language and more and more people began to write in Italian and ultimately Italian became a cultured and literary language. It is due to the impact of his writing in Italian, he is being called father of modern Italian language.

How many jews died when hitler was in charge? how many jews died during the holocaust?
lara31 [8.8K]
Adolf Hitler lead the Holocaust so the answer would be the same for both questions. The answer to those is between five and six million Jews died during the Holocaust. It is impossible to know how many Jews died exactly though.
